July 31, 2018
Accused EB-5 Scammers Slapped With $1.8M Default
A California federal judge on Monday entered a default judgment against two people involved in an alleged scheme to defraud a Chinese investor seeking a green card through the EB-5 visa program, saying they will join several other defendants in paying $1.8 million for failing to respond to the lawsuit.
